// function modul_func(){
    // document.Formular.p_name.value = userArray[7];
    // document.Formular.p_strasse.value = userArray[8];
    // document.Formular.p_plz.value = userArray[9];
    // document.Formular.p_funktion.value = userArray[10];
    // document.Formular.p_email.value = userArray[11];
    // document.Formular.u_name.value = userArray[12];
    // document.Formular.unternehmen.value = userArray[13];
    // document.Formular.u_strasse.value = userArray[14];
    // document.Formular.u_plz.value = userArray[15];
    // document.Formular.u_funktion.value = userArray[16];
    // document.Formular.u_email.value = userArray[17];
    // document.Formular.email.value = userArray[17];
    // for (var i = 18; i <= 23; i++){
        // SetCheckBox(nameArray[i],userArray[i].length);
    // }
    // document.getElementById("modul").options[0].selected=true;
    // fillFields(0);
// }

// function SetCheckBox(id,wert)
// {
    // if(wert == 0)
    // {
     // document.getElementById(id).checked = false
    // }
    // else
    // {
     // document.getElementById(id).checked = true
    // }
// }

// function teilnehmer_func() {
    // index = selectOptionByValue(document.getElementById("modul"), userArray[0]);
    // fillFields(index.toString())
    // index_gk1 = selectOptionByValue(document.getElementById("termin_gk1"), userArray[3]);
    // index_gk2 = selectOptionByValue(document.getElementById("termin_gk2"), userArray[4]);
    // index_ak1 = selectOptionByValue(document.getElementById("termin_ak1"), userArray[5]);
    // index_ak2 = selectOptionByValue(document.getElementById("termin_ak2"), userArray[6]);
    // emptyAll();
    // document.getElementById("rechnung_p").checked = true
// }

// function selectOptionByValue(sel,indexvalue) {
	// var i=0;
	// for (i=0;i<=sel.options.length;i++){
		// if(sel[i].value==indexvalue){ 
			// sel.options[i].selected=true;
            // return i;
		// }
	// }
// } 

// function emptyAll(){
    // document.Formular.p_name.value = '';
    // document.Formular.p_strasse.value = '';
    // document.Formular.p_plz.value = '';
    // document.Formular.p_funktion.value = '';
    // document.Formular.p_email.value = '';
    // document.Formular.u_name.value = '';
    // document.Formular.unternehmen.value = '';
    // document.Formular.u_strasse.value = '';
    // document.Formular.u_plz.value = '';
    // document.Formular.u_funktion.value = '';
    // document.Formular.u_email.value = '';
    // for (var i = 18; i <= 23; i++){
        // SetCheckBox(nameArray[i],0);
    // }
// }

// function changeModul(){
    // document.Formular.thema_1.value='';
    // document.Formular.thema_2.value='';
    
    // document.Formular.termin_gk1.options.length = 1;
    // document.Formular.termin_gk2.options.length = 1;
    // document.Formular.termin_ak1.options.length = 1;
    // document.Formular.termin_ak2.options.length = 1;
// }

// function fillFields(userSelect) {
    // if(userSelect==0){
        // changeModul();
    // } else {
        // changeModul();
        
        // document.Formular.thema_1.value=themenArray[userSelect+0];
        // document.Formular.thema_2.value=themenArray[userSelect+1];
        // var gk1=true;
        // var gk2=true;
        // var ak1=true;
        // var ak2=true;
        // for (var i=parseInt(userSelect+0+0+0); i<terminArray.length; i++){
            // if(typeof terminArray[i]!='undefined'){
                // if(gk1==true){
                    // document.Formular.termin_gk1.options[document.Formular.termin_gk1.length] = new Option(terminArray[i], terminArray[i], false, true);
                    // gk1=false;
                // } else {
                    // document.Formular.termin_gk1.options[document.Formular.termin_gk1.length] = new Option(terminArray[i], terminArray[i]);
                // }
             // } else {
                // break;
            // }
         // }
         // for (var i=parseInt(userSelect+1+0+0); i<terminArray.length; i++){
            // if(typeof terminArray[i]!='undefined'){
                // if(gk2==true){
                    // document.Formular.termin_gk2.options[document.Formular.termin_gk2.length] = new Option(terminArray[i], terminArray[i], false, true);
                    // gk2=false;
                // } else {
                    // document.Formular.termin_gk2.options[document.Formular.termin_gk2.length] = new Option(terminArray[i], terminArray[i]);                    
                // }
             // } else {
                // break;
            // }
             
         // }
         // for (var i=parseInt(userSelect+0+1+0); i<terminArray.length; i++){
            // if(typeof terminArray[i]!='undefined'){
                // if(ak1==true){
                    // document.Formular.termin_ak1.options[document.Formular.termin_ak1.length] = new Option(terminArray[i], terminArray[i], false, true);
                    // ak1=false;
                // } else {
                    // document.Formular.termin_ak1.options[document.Formular.termin_ak1.length] = new Option(terminArray[i], terminArray[i]);
                // }
             // } else {
                // break;
            // }
         // }
         // for (var i=parseInt(userSelect+1+1+0); i<terminArray.length; i++){
            // if(typeof terminArray[i]!='undefined'){
                // if(ak2==true){
                    // document.Formular.termin_ak2.options[document.Formular.termin_ak2.length] = new Option(terminArray[i], terminArray[i], false, true);
                    // ak2=false;
                // } else {
                    // document.Formular.termin_ak2.options[document.Formular.termin_ak2.length] = new Option(terminArray[i], terminArray[i]);   
                // }
             // } else {
                // break;
            // }
         // }
     // }
// }

function modul_func(){
    document.Formular.p_name.value = userArray[7];
    document.Formular.p_strasse.value = userArray[8];
    document.Formular.p_plz.value = userArray[9];
    document.Formular.p_funktion.value = userArray[10];
    document.Formular.p_email.value = userArray[11];
    document.Formular.u_name.value = userArray[12];
    document.Formular.unternehmen.value = userArray[13];
    document.Formular.u_strasse.value = userArray[14];
    document.Formular.u_plz.value = userArray[15];
    document.Formular.u_funktion.value = userArray[16];
    document.Formular.u_email.value = userArray[17];
    document.Formular.email.value = userArray[17];
    for (var i = 18; i <= 25; i++){
        SetCheckBox(nameArray[i],userArray[i].length);
    }
    document.getElementById("modul").options[0].selected=true;
    fillFields(0);
}

function SetCheckBox(id,wert)
{
    if(wert == 0)
    {
     document.getElementById(id).checked = false
    }
    else
    {
     document.getElementById(id).checked = true
    }
}

// function teilnehmer_func() {
    // index = selectOptionByValue(document.getElementById("modul"), userArray[0]);
    // fillFields(index.toString())
	
    // index_gk1 = selectOptionByValue(document.getElementById("termin_gk1"), userArray[3]);
    // index_gk2 = selectOptionByValue(document.getElementById("termin_gk2"), userArray[4]);
    // index_ak1 = selectOptionByValue(document.getElementById("termin_ak1"), userArray[5]);
    // index_ak2 = selectOptionByValue(document.getElementById("termin_ak2"), userArray[6]);
    // emptyAll();
    // document.getElementById("rechnung_p").checked = true
// }

function teilnehmer_func() {
    index = selectOptionByValue(document.getElementById("modul"), userArray[0]);
    fillFields(index.toString())
	
    index_gk1 = selectOptionByValue(document.getElementById("termin_gk1"), userArray[3]);
	document.Formular.termin_gk2.value=userArray[4];
    document.Formular.termin_ak1.value=userArray[5];
    document.Formular.termin_ak2.value=userArray[6];
    emptyAll();
    document.getElementById("rechnung_p").checked = true
}



function selectOptionByValue(sel,indexvalue) {
	var i=0;
	for (i=0;i<sel.options.length;i++){
		if(sel[i].value==indexvalue){ 
			sel.options[i].selected=true;
            return i;
		}
	}
} 

function emptyAll(){
    document.Formular.p_name.value = '';
    document.Formular.p_strasse.value = '';
    document.Formular.p_plz.value = '';
    document.Formular.p_funktion.value = '';
    document.Formular.p_email.value = '';
    document.Formular.u_name.value = '';
    document.Formular.unternehmen.value = '';
    document.Formular.u_strasse.value = '';
    document.Formular.u_plz.value = '';
    document.Formular.u_funktion.value = '';
    document.Formular.u_email.value = '';
    for (var i = 18; i <= 23; i++){
        SetCheckBox(nameArray[i],0);
    }
}

function changeModul(){
    document.Formular.thema_1.value='';
    document.Formular.thema_2.value='';
    
    document.Formular.termin_gk1.options.length = 1;
    document.Formular.termin_gk2.value='';
    document.Formular.termin_ak1.value='';
    document.Formular.termin_ak2.value='';
}


function fillDates(userSelect, modulSelect) {
	// alert(userSelect + ' -> ' + modulSelect);
		if(typeof terminArray[parseInt(modulSelect+0+1+userSelect)-1]!='undefined'){
			document.Formular.termin_gk2.value=' '+terminArray[parseInt(modulSelect+1+0+userSelect)-1];
		} else {
			document.Formular.termin_gk2.value= ''; 
		}
		if(typeof terminArray[parseInt(modulSelect+1+0+userSelect)-1]!='undefined'){
			document.Formular.termin_ak1.value=' '+terminArray[parseInt(modulSelect+0+1+userSelect)-1];
		} else {
			document.Formular.termin_ak1.value= ''; 
		}
		if(typeof terminArray[parseInt(modulSelect+1+1+userSelect)-1]!='undefined'){
			document.Formular.termin_ak2.value=' '+terminArray[parseInt(modulSelect+1+1+userSelect)-1];
		} else {
			document.Formular.termin_ak2.value= ''; 
		}
}


function fillFields(userSelect) {
    if(userSelect==0){
        changeModul();
    } else {
        changeModul();
        
        document.Formular.thema_1.value=themenArray[userSelect+0];
		document.Formular.thema_2.value=themenArray[userSelect+1];
		
		if(typeof terminArray[parseInt(userSelect+0+1+0)]!='undefined'){
			document.Formular.termin_gk2.value=' '+terminArray[parseInt(userSelect+1+0+0)];
		} else {
			document.Formular.termin_gk2.value= ''; 
		}
		if(typeof terminArray[parseInt(userSelect+1+0+0)]!='undefined'){
			document.Formular.termin_ak1.value=' '+terminArray[parseInt(userSelect+0+1+0)];
		} else {
			document.Formular.termin_ak1.value= ''; 
		}
		if(typeof terminArray[parseInt(userSelect+1+1+0)]!='undefined'){
			document.Formular.termin_ak2.value=' '+terminArray[parseInt(userSelect+1+1+0)];
		} else {
			document.Formular.termin_ak2.value= ''; 
		}
        
        var gk1=true;
        // var gk2=true;
        // var ak1=true;
        // var ak2=true;
        for (var i=parseInt(userSelect+0+0+0); i<terminArray.length; i++){
            if(typeof terminArray[i]!='undefined'){
                if(gk1==true){
                    document.Formular.termin_gk1.options[document.Formular.termin_gk1.length] = new Option(terminArray[i], terminArray[i], false, true);
                    gk1=false;
                } else {
                    document.Formular.termin_gk1.options[document.Formular.termin_gk1.length] = new Option(terminArray[i], terminArray[i]);
                }
             } else {
                break;
            }
         }
         // for (var i=parseInt(userSelect+1+0+0); i<terminArray.length; i++){
            // if(typeof terminArray[i]!='undefined'){
                // if(gk2==true){
                    // document.Formular.termin_gk2.options[document.Formular.termin_gk2.length] = new Option(terminArray[i], terminArray[i], false, true);
                    // gk2=false;
                // } else {
                    // document.Formular.termin_gk2.options[document.Formular.termin_gk2.length] = new Option(terminArray[i], terminArray[i]);                    
                // }
             // } else {
                // break;
            // }
             
         // }
         // for (var i=parseInt(userSelect+0+1+0); i<terminArray.length; i++){
            // if(typeof terminArray[i]!='undefined'){
                // if(ak1==true){
                    // document.Formular.termin_ak1.options[document.Formular.termin_ak1.length] = new Option(terminArray[i], terminArray[i], false, true);
                    // ak1=false;
                // } else {
                    // document.Formular.termin_ak1.options[document.Formular.termin_ak1.length] = new Option(terminArray[i], terminArray[i]);
                // }
             // } else {
                // break;
            // }
         // }
         // for (var i=parseInt(userSelect+1+1+0); i<terminArray.length; i++){
            // if(typeof terminArray[i]!='undefined'){
                // if(ak2==true){
                    // document.Formular.termin_ak2.options[document.Formular.termin_ak2.length] = new Option(terminArray[i], terminArray[i], false, true);
                    // ak2=false;
                // } else {
                    // document.Formular.termin_ak2.options[document.Formular.termin_ak2.length] = new Option(terminArray[i], terminArray[i]);   
                // }
             // } else {
                // break;
            // }
         // }
     // }
}
}

